A one-person monthly baseline (1BR rent plus typical utilities) runs $1,030 in Hattiesburg, MS versus $1,120 in Provo, UT. Overall, Hattiesburg, MS is roughly 8% cheaper to live in day-to-day than Provo, UT, driven mainly by rent.

Median household income is $44,140 in Hattiesburg, MS and $62,800 in Provo, UT — about 30% higher in Provo, UT. Mississippi has a top state income tax rate of 4.00% and a 7% state sales tax; Utah has a top state income tax rate of 4.50% and a 6.1% state sales tax.

Hattiesburg vs Provo — FAQ

Is it cheaper to live in Hattiesburg or Provo?
Hattiesburg, MS is cheaper. Its monthly baseline of $1,030 (1BR rent + utilities) runs about 8% below Provo, UT's $1,120, mainly because of rent.
How much more do you need to earn to live in Hattiesburg than in Provo?
To keep rent near the recommended 30% of gross income, you'd want to earn roughly $34,000 a year in Hattiesburg versus $39,000 in Provo.
Which has lower taxes, Hattiesburg or Provo?
Hattiesburg is taxed under Mississippi's rules (a top state income tax rate of 4.00% and a 7% state sales tax); Provo under Utah's (a top state income tax rate of 4.50% and a 6.1% state sales tax).
